What Affects Residential & Commercial Roofing Costs in Crystal Hill?

Understanding pricing factors helps you budget accurately and avoid surprises

📊

labor costs

Labor rates in Halifax County reflect the local cost of living and the availability of skilled roofing crews. Being a rural area, there are fewer roofing contractors operating in Crystal Hill compared to larger metro areas, which can mean slightly higher per-square labor costs due to travel time and smaller crew pools. Experienced residential and commercial crews often command a premium for specialties like metal roofing or flat roof systems.

📊

market dynamics

Supply and demand in Crystal Hill fluctuate with broader construction trends in Southside Virginia. When new home construction or commercial development in the area picks up, roofing crews get booked out further, and pricing can tighten. Conversely, during slower periods, homeowners and business owners may find more competitive bids. Material costs — especially asphalt shingles, metal panels, and commercial membrane — are subject to regional supply chain factors affecting the Halifax County area.

📊

seasonal trends

Roofing in Crystal Hill follows a distinct seasonal pattern. Spring and fall are peak seasons, with mild weather leading to higher demand and potentially longer lead times for scheduling. Summer heat can slow down tar and asphalt work but is still a busy period. Winter months — particularly December through February — see lower demand, and some contractors may offer more flexible scheduling or slightly more competitive pricing to keep crews working. However, cold-weather installations require careful attention to sealant and material handling.

🧱 Key Pricing Components

  • Roof size and pitch — Larger roofs and steeper pitches require more materials and safety equipment, increasing labor time and overall cost.
  • Material type — Asphalt shingles are generally the most budget-friendly, while metal, slate, tile, and commercial TPO/PVC systems cost significantly more in materials and installation complexity.
  • Tear-off vs. overlay — Removing old roofing layers adds disposal fees and labor. An overlay (layering new over old) can save money but isn't always allowed by local building codes.
  • Roof complexity — Dormers, skylights, chimneys, valleys, and multiple roof planes all add time and require specialized flashing work, raising the total cost.
  • Access and site conditions — Hard-to-access roofs, multi-story buildings, and tight job sites may require extra equipment like lifts or cranes, adding to the quote.
  • Permits and disposal fees — Halifax County permit fees and dumpster/ debris removal costs are separate line items that should be included in any written estimate.

How to Save Money on Residential & Commercial Roofing

Smart strategies to get quality service without overpaying

🗣️

Tip

Get at least three written estimates — Comparing multiple itemized quotes from local Crystal Hill contractors helps you spot fair pricing and identify outliers.

🗣️

Tip

Ask about material grades — Shingles, underlayment, and flashing come in different quality tiers. Make sure each quote specifies the exact brands and product lines being used.

🗣️

Tip

Confirm warranty coverage — A good roofing quote includes both a manufacturer's material warranty and a workmanship warranty from the contractor. Clarify the length and what's covered.

🗣️

Tip

Check for license and insurance — Virginia requires contractors to carry general liability and workers' compensation insurance. Always verify before allowing work to begin.

⚠️ Watch Out For

Pricing Red Flags

Warning Sign

Extremely low bids — A quote that comes in far below others in Crystal Hill may indicate cut-rate materials, unlicensed labor, or a crew that cuts corners on safety and installation quality.

Warning Sign

High-pressure tactics — Contractors who demand large upfront deposits, push you to sign same-day contracts, or claim a 'discount expires today' are often using pressure to hide poor terms.

Warning Sign

Vague or verbal-only estimates — Any contractor unwilling to provide a detailed, written breakdown of materials, labor, permits, and disposal fees should raise immediate concern.

💬 What is the most affordable roofing material in Crystal Hill?

Asphalt shingles are generally the most cost-effective roofing material available in the Crystal Hill area. They offer good durability for the price and are widely installed by local contractors. However, the total cost also depends on roof pitch, tear-off requirements, and local labor rates.

💬 Do I need a permit for a roof replacement in Halifax County?

Yes, most roof replacements in Halifax County require a building permit. Repairs may or may not need one depending on the scope. A reputable roofing contractor will handle the permit process and include the fee in their quote. Always confirm this before work begins.

💬 How long does a typical roof installation take in Crystal Hill?

A standard residential asphalt shingle roof replacement typically takes 1 to 3 days for a crew of experienced roofers, depending on the size and complexity of the roof. Commercial projects and complex residential roofs (steep pitches, multiple valleys) can take longer. Weather in the Crystal Hill area can also affect the timeline.

💬 Is metal roofing more expensive than shingles in Crystal Hill?

Yes, metal roofing generally costs more upfront than asphalt shingles due to higher material prices and specialized installation labor. However, metal roofs often last longer and may offer energy efficiency benefits, which can offset the higher initial investment over time.

💬 When is the best time of year to get a roof done in Crystal Hill?

Spring and fall offer the most moderate weather for roofing work in Crystal Hill. Winter months see lower demand, which may lead to more flexible scheduling, but cold weather can affect material performance. Summer is busy and hot, so crews work carefully to manage heat safety and material curing.
